WebNov 17, 2015 · How a sway bar works Every sway bar is a torsion spring — a piece of metal that resists twisting force. The sway bar is attached at each end, one end to one wheel and at the other end to the opposite wheel (both fronts or both rears) so that in order for the wheel on one side to be higher than that on the other the bar has to twist. Web1) Anti-Sway Bars. Anti-sway bars are connected to your hitch and the tongue of your trailer. They reduce trailer sway through the use of friction. The additional bar essentially reduces a trailer’s side-to-side movement. An anti-sway bar kit will usually come with a hitch ball, a sway control arm and the pins and mounting hardware that you ...
